    I have had similar problems with Chatterbox.com and pursued the company via moneyclaim online  They paid the full amount owed to me plus the £30 court costs within 6 days (c.£267) of making the claim.  Their trading address is:-

    Chatterbox.com Ltd

    49 Salusbury Road

    London, NW6 6NJ

    Best of luck.

    A Group Litigation Order can be made in any Claim where there are multiple parties or Claimants to the same cause of action. The Order will provide for the case management of claims which give rise to common or related issues of fact or law. These will be specified in the Order as the GLO Issues. The Law Society may be able to assist in putting the applicant in touch with other parties who may also be interested in applying for a Group Litigation Order in their case. When an Order has been made a Group Register will be set up and maintained in the Management Court, of all the parties to the group of claims being managed. A Group Litigation Order will normally be publicised through the Law Society
